    Cultural Safety

    Culturally Safe Support for Aboriginal & Torres Strait Islander People

    Over 30% of the NT population is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ander. NDHS is committed to providing services that respect and celebrate First Nations cultures, languages, and ways of living.

    Indigenous Staff & Leadership

    Our NT team includes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ander staff at all levels. This ensures cultural knowledge informs our services.

    Working with Elders

    We consult with Elders and community leaders when developing services, ensuring we respect cultural protocols and community structures.

    Family & Kinship

    We understand that family and kinship networks are central to many participants' lives. We work with families and respect these relationships.

    Flexible Service Delivery

    Cultural business, sorry business, and community events take priority. We adjust our services around cultural obligations.
